Senior Engineer for FPGA Development
Deadline: 13 March 2021
Employment term: Permanent
Category: Software development
Job type: Full time
Location: Yerevan
Job description:
Instigate Semiconductor CJSC in partnership with world leading Semiconductor and Electronic System Solutions provider is looking for team players to join its current team in Yerevan.
We are looking for a Senior engineer as a full-time team member who will participate in the design/development and testing phases of the project by understanding customer requirements, undertaking design activities, performing development/coding/testing, consulting/mentoring junior team members, discussing and deciding development plans/procedures.
/en/senior-engineer-for-fpga-development-1
Job responsibilities
- design/implementation/integration of IP modules, creation of HW/SW verification/validation test-benches
- debugging Verilog RTL, generated bit-streams, building CAD flows for EDA tools
- investigation of benchmark and complex designs for QoR analysis, find QoR outliers
- coding with C/C++ for firmware/drivers, develop IFS/GUI with C++/QT, review/improve the existing codes
- preparing necessary technical documentation
- communicating effectively with team members handling communication/conference calls with customers at late hours if required
- handle assignments in both R&D and QA projects
- applying best practice techniques: monitor and input into the organization's standards and processes
- work as a part of the team: help team to grow in knowledge, participate in management discussions, help to grow junior members of the team, support long-term company growth
Required qualifications
- knowledge of FPGA architecture and FPGA tool flows
- experience in Verilog/SystemVerilog/VHDL
- experience in TCL/Python scripting languages
- experience in C++/QT
- experience in development/maintenance of coverage-driven test environments
- working experience in SCRUM/Agile development process, including related tools like Confluence, Git, Svn, Redmine, SAR or similar
- excellent interpersonal and communication skills and ability to professionally interact with diverse group of staff and customer
- professional knowledge of English language (verbal and written skills)
- positive, constructive and can do/learn attitude
Required candidate level: Senior
Additional information
Interested candidates should send their CV to [email protected] email address indicating the position title in the subject line of the email.
Professional skills
Python
Scrum
TCL
C++
Qt
Agile
Soft skills
Leadership skills
Positive attitude
Time management
Problem solving
Teamwork
Share this job via your favorite social media channel.